Transaction 49564635bb54ccd8257fb631fc849dc8ccdeec0cfaa4aa7bba80fe0692a28588
1 Input
1 Output
-
49564635bb54ccd8257fb631fc849dc8ccdeec0cfaa4aa7bba80fe0692a28588:0
- value
- 16493
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 441e8636ac8b9de23b1d565644e3eec41b0f451a OP_EQUAL
- address
- 37uCSTA8K9F9BaHGwWkVxSX3fW98tqvSMb